Solving a 1-D inverse medium scattering problem using a new multi-frequency globally strictly convex objective functional.

Abstract
- We propose a new approach to constructing globally strictly convex objective functional in a 1-D inverse medium scattering problem using multi-frequency backscattering data. The global convexity of the proposed objective functional is proved. We also prove the global convergence of the gradient projection algorithm and derive an error estimate. Numerical examples are presented to illustrate the performance of the proposed algorithm. [ABSTRACT FROM AUTHOR]
